Superset을 사용하여 데이터를 인터랙티브하게 시각화하는 방법을 알려주세요.

Superset은 오픈 소스 비즈니스 인텔리전스(BI) 도구로, 데이터를 시각화하고 인터랙티브한 대시보드를 생성하는 기능을 제공합니다. 이번 포스트에서는 Superset을 사용하여 데이터를 인터랙티브하게 시각화하는 방법에 대해 알아보겠습니다.

1. Superset 설치

먼저, Superset을 설치해야 합니다. 이를 위해서는 Python과 필요한 의존성 패키지들을 설치하는 과정이 필요합니다. Superset의 설치 가이드는 공식 문서에서 확인할 수 있습니다.

2. 데이터 소스 연결

Superset을 설치하고 나면, 데이터 소스를 연결해야 합니다. Superset은 다양한 데이터 소스와 연동할 수 있습니다. DBMS, 빅데이터 시스템 등 데이터 소스에 따라 연결 방법이 다를 수 있습니다. 공식 문서에서 각 데이터 소스에 대한 연결 방법을 확인할 수 있습니다.

3. 대시보드 만들기

Superset에서 데이터를 시각화하려면 대시보드를 만들어야 합니다. 대시보드는 여러 개의 시각화 차트로 구성됩니다. 대시보드를 만들기 위해서는 적절한 데이터 소스를 선택하고, 시각화에 사용할 쿼리를 작성해야 합니다. Superset은 SQL 쿼리를 작성할 수 있는 에디터를 제공하므로, SQL 문법을 알고 있다면 원하는 데이터를 추출하고 가공할 수 있습니다.

또한, Superset은 다양한 시각화 차트를 지원합니다. 라인 차트, 막대 그래프, 히트맵 등 다양한 시각화 유형을 선택할 수 있으며, 차트의 속성을 조정하여 원하는 모양으로 꾸밀 수 있습니다.

4. 대시보드 공유 및 인터랙티브한 시각화

대시보드를 만들고 나면, 해당 대시보드를 다른 사람과 공유할 수 있습니다. 대시보드를 공유하면 다른 사용자들은 해당 대시보드를 통해 데이터를 조회하고 인터랙티브하게 시각화할 수 있습니다. 대시보드는 다양한 필터링 및 상호작용 기능을 제공하여 사용자들이 데이터에 대한 통찰력을 얻을 수 있도록 도와줍니다.

결론

Superset은 데이터를 인터랙티브하게 시각화할 수 있는 강력한 도구입니다. 데이터 소스와 연결하고, 적절한 쿼리를 작성하여 원하는 형태의 시각화 차트를 생성하고 공유할 수 있습니다. 데이터에 대한 통찰력을 갖고자 한다면 Superset을 사용해보는 것을 추천합니다.

#DataVisualization #BusinessIntelligence